Explorer Extension is a free Windows software that offers a subset of the decoding features of Directory Toolkit. It enables users to decode internet email messages and attachments stored in files.

The extension enables you to decode several attachment types, including Base64(MIME), UUENCODED, XXENCODED, BinHex (Mac format), XXENCODED, printed-quoteable, User (table), and plain text encoding. You can do this by simply right-clicking on the file in Windows Explorer and selecting the "Decode" option from the menu.
